Thanks all for helping verify the RC2.

But my team member found a bug that in KRaft mode, we'll log every commit
message in info level, with `handleSnapshot: xxx`.
That means, in KRaft mode, the active controller log will be flooded with
this message every 500ms (default no-op message commit interval).

I've opened a PR to fix it: https://github.com/apache/kafka/pull/13763.
After this PR merged, I'll create another RC.

> I ran the following validation steps:
> - Built from source with Java 11 and Scala 2.13
> - Signatures and hashes of the artifacts generated
> - Navigated through Javadoc including links to JDK classes
> - Run the unit tests
> - Run integration tests
> - Run the quickstart in KRaft and Zookeeper mode
> - Checked that the diff in LICENSE-binary (between this and previous RC) is
> correct
> -- For each difference I checked the binary on the scala 2.13 package had
> the version specified in the file
>
> This gets a +1 from me.
